Exoplanets are planets that orbit stars outside our solar system, and their discovery has revolutionized our understanding of the universe and the potential for life beyond Earth. Scientists study exoplanets to learn about their sizes, compositions, atmospheres, and orbital dynamics, using techniques like transit observations and radial velocity measurements. Some exoplanets resemble Earth, raising exciting possibilities about habitable conditions and biosignatures.
